Note:-
- Rooting will void your phone warranty, and you won’t claim it back.
- Follow the steps correctly otherwise you may brick your device. We are not responsible for any damage of your phone.
- It will erase all your personal data including data of internal storage, so we advise you first to take a complete backup of your phone and then proceed.
- Ensure that your phone has at least 50-60% charged to prevent the accidental shutdown in-between the process.
Files required to Root and Install Custom Recovery on Mi4 –
- Download ADB and fastboot driver for windows or ADB and Fastboot for Mac and install it on your PC. This will also install your device driver.
- Download TWRP 3.0 Recovery for Mi 4.
- Download SuperSu to root Mi 4 and copy it to your phone sd card.
Steps to Root and Install TWRP Recovery on Xiaomi Mi 4 –
1) First, enable ‘USB debugging’ option from setting>developer option>. To enable Developer Options, go to About phone and tap the Build Number 7 times.
2) Download TWRP 3.0.0 for Xiaomi Mi 4 from above and place it in the folder where ADB installed and rename it to ‘recovery.img’.
3) Now go to installation directory open ADB folder and open the command window thereby pressing and hold the ‘shift’ key and right-clicked anywhere in that folder.
4) Now connect your phone to PC and reboot the device into fastboot mode by typing below.
adb reboot bootloader
5) You are in Fastboot mode now to check your connection by entering below command in command prompt. It will return your device serial number means your device properly connected. Check your driver if the above command is not responding.
fastboot devices
6) Type the below command correctly in command prompt and then press enter. It starts flashing recovery on your phone.
fastboot flash recovery recovery.img
7) Now type below command in command prompt to reboot your phone into recovery mode. Now you successfully installed the custom recovery on Xiaomi Mi 4.
fastboot boot recovery.img
8) With above command your phone boot into the recovery mode.
9) In TWRP recovery navigate to Install Zip and select ‘SuperSu.zip’ to root Xiaomi Mi 4
13) Swipe to install SuperSu and reboot your device. That’s it, you root Mi 4 and install custom recovery on Xiaomi Mi 4 successfully.
